Farcry on a Wii
Following yesterday’s news of Nintendo looking to put M-rated games on their newest console comes the confirmation of Farcry flexing it’s muscles (and yours) on the Wii.
This just helps to reinforce that the console will no longer be the “kiddie” platform it’s predcessors have been. Mario may have to trade in the koopa shells for some pistol rounds.
